// Default role bitmask for new Loomwiki spaces.
// Grants read + comment; edit requires explicit promotion
// by a space steward. Release managers: changing this value
// retroactively affects all spaces created after deploy, so
// coordinate with the permissions audit before shipping.
// Last verified against the access-control suite on the build below.

session token of kafof-kafop = htk31_c3becf8b8eac3ed970037fba36e258e

- [ ] Step 7: Archive cold storage buckets (Glacierline tier). Confirm both ceremony witnesses are present, verify bucket manifests match the Oxbow ledger, then seal the archive key shares. Plugin authors may observe but not handle shares. Once sealed, the archive index itself is encrypted and can only be reopened with the passphrase below.

vault phrase of badup-hahig = tamael-aldael-kelmir-istael-fenok-istwyn-tamius-jorath-oliion

// Heads up, new folks: this constant pins the wire-protocol version we speak
// to Quillbus, our message broker. We're mid-upgrade from the old Quillbus 3
// cluster in the Tarnow datacenter to the shiny Quillbus 4 ring, and the two
// versions disagree about frame headers. Until the migration team (ping Marisol
// on the Relay squad) gives the all-clear, do NOT bump this past 3. Seriously,
// production will scream. Every change here must reference the broker build it
// was validated against, which is recorded below.

trace token, fafog-kageg: htk4_98e6